This thrilling addition to the bestselling Private series transports readers inside the halls of the Vatican itself when a priest is murdered—and the new lead agent at Private is the number one suspect.

Jack Morgan, ex-Marine helicopter pilot and CIA agent, is in Italy to open the latest outpost of his international private investigation firm. Its wealthy client base demands maximum force and maximum discretion.
But when a priest is murdered at the firm’s opening party, Morgan and Matteo Ricci—a decorated former Rome police inspector, now Morgan’s newly appointed deputy—come under intense scrutiny. As Morgan and Ricci work the case, they discover that eight priests have died, all under watch of the Swiss Guard and the Vatican Police.
Private relies on the world’s most advanced forensic tools to make and break cases. This one rests on breaking the secret hold of the Holy See’s all-powerful, all knowing inner circle.
